Maxima of the Q-index: Graphs with no K1,t-minor
Abstract
A graph is said to be H-minor free if it does not contain H as a minor. In this paper, we characteristic the unique extremal graph with maximal Q-index among all n-vertex K1,t-minor free graphs (t3).
